Transaction 7cbc28a937289c152b5fa07b7cf99f23644b33e7cf1885d1a70fa07da6eb6d14
1 Input
1 Output
-
7cbc28a937289c152b5fa07b7cf99f23644b33e7cf1885d1a70fa07da6eb6d14:0
- value
- 599934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e5b6d121700548aa58bc89fbea481e15018ed09 OP_EQUAL
- address
- 3DD8b7EGzowdMiQjTf9ffei74kpEuX4oHN